Claude AI là gì? Vì sao dân lập trình lại nói nhiều về Claude Code?
Vài năm gần đây, khi nhắc đến AI, nhiều người thường nghĩ ngay tới ChatGPT hoặc Gemini. Nhưng trong giới lập trình, có một cái tên được nhắc rất nhiều: Claude. Đặc biệt là Claude Code — công cụ khiến nhiều developer cảm giác như có một “đồng nghiệp AI” ngồi đọc cả dự án rồi sửa code cùng mình.
Hiểu đơn giản, Claude là họ mô hình trí tuệ nhân tạo do Anthropic phát triển. Nó có thể trò chuyện, viết nội dung, phân tích tài liệu, đọc code, giải thích logic và hỗ trợ lập trình. Nhưng điểm khiến Claude được cộng đồng kỹ thuật đánh giá cao là khả năng xử lý ngữ cảnh dài, đọc được nhiều thông tin cùng lúc và làm việc khá tốt với các dự án code lớn.

Token trong Claude là gì?
Token là đơn vị đo lượng dữ liệu mà AI phải đọc và viết. Nó không phải đồng xu, không phải điểm thưởng, cũng không phải thứ Claude “lấy” từ đâu ra. Mỗi câu hỏi, mỗi dòng code, mỗi file trong dự án, mỗi đoạn lịch sử trò chuyện đều được chuyển thành token trước khi đưa vào model xử lý.
Ví dụ, khi bạn gõ một câu rất ngắn như “sửa bug đăng nhập”, Claude Code có thể phải đọc nhiều file liên quan đến authentication, đọc cấu trúc project, xem lịch sử thay đổi, rồi mới viết lại code. Vì vậy một yêu cầu nhìn bên ngoài rất ngắn nhưng phía sau có thể tiêu tốn rất nhiều token.
Nói vui thì token với AI giống như điện với điều hòa hoặc xăng với ô tô. Dùng càng nhiều dữ liệu, đọc càng nhiều file, trò chuyện càng dài, model càng phải tiêu tốn nhiều token hơn.
Claude Code khác gì Claude bình thường?
Claude bình thường giống một chatbot AI để hỏi đáp, viết nội dung hoặc phân tích tài liệu. Còn Claude Code là một công cụ làm việc trực tiếp trong terminal, được thiết kế cho lập trình viên. Nó có thể đọc codebase, hiểu cấu trúc dự án, sửa file, giải thích lỗi, viết test, refactor code và hỗ trợ các thao tác git bằng ngôn ngữ tự nhiên.
Điểm quan trọng là Claude Code không chạy toàn bộ AI trên máy tính của bạn. Máy của bạn chỉ đóng vai trò đọc file local, gửi phần cần thiết lên hệ thống của Anthropic, rồi nhận kết quả trả về. Vì vậy bạn không cần máy tính có GPU quá mạnh vẫn dùng được Claude Code.
Claude mạnh nhất ở đâu?
Nếu nhìn theo cách dễ hiểu, ChatGPT là AI đa năng, Gemini mạnh về hệ sinh thái Google và đa phương thức, còn Claude được nhiều developer thích vì khả năng đọc hiểu codebase lớn, giữ ngữ cảnh dài và xử lý các tác vụ lập trình phức tạp khá chắc tay.
Claude không chỉ giỏi viết vài dòng code lẻ. Điểm đáng giá của nó là khả năng ngồi đọc cả một dự án, hiểu mối liên hệ giữa các file rồi mới đề xuất cách sửa. Với những việc như refactor, review code, viết tài liệu kỹ thuật, phân tích bug hoặc giải thích một hệ thống cũ, Claude thường cho cảm giác rất “chịu đọc trước khi viết”.
Context Window – thứ khiến Claude nổi tiếng trong giới kỹ thuật
Nếu phải chọn một công nghệ đứng sau danh tiếng của Claude thì đó không phải tốc độ trả lời hay khả năng viết code, mà là context window — hiểu đơn giản là lượng thông tin AI có thể giữ trong đầu cùng một lúc.
Ví dụ dễ hình dung: một AI có context nhỏ giống như một người chỉ được đọc vài chương của cuốn sách rồi phải trả lời câu hỏi. Trong khi đó Claude được thiết kế để xử lý lượng ngữ cảnh lớn hơn, nên có thể đọc nhiều tài liệu, nhiều file hoặc nhiều đoạn hội thoại hơn trước khi đưa ra kết luận.
Điều này đặc biệt hữu ích với lập trình. Một bug đôi khi không nằm ở file đang mở mà xuất phát từ mối liên hệ giữa nhiều module khác nhau. Context lớn giúp AI hiểu hệ thống thay vì chỉ sửa từng dòng code riêng lẻ.
Claude có thật sự đọc toàn bộ dự án không?
Một hiểu nhầm phổ biến là nhiều người nghĩ Claude Code sẽ tự động đọc toàn bộ source code ngay khi chạy. Thực tế không hẳn như vậy.
Claude Code hoạt động theo kiểu thu thập ngữ cảnh cần thiết. Tùy câu lệnh, quyền truy cập và cách người dùng sử dụng, công cụ sẽ đọc những phần liên quan rồi gửi lên model xử lý. Trong nhiều trường hợp, nó không cần mở toàn bộ repository.
Ví dụ nếu yêu cầu là sửa chức năng đăng nhập, công cụ có thể chỉ tập trung vào thư mục authentication, API liên quan và các file cấu hình cần thiết thay vì quét toàn bộ dự án.
Đây cũng là lý do người dùng có kinh nghiệm thường mô tả phạm vi rất cụ thể để tiết kiệm thời gian và giảm lượng token tiêu thụ.
Claude có an toàn không? Code có bị gửi lên máy chủ không?
Đây là câu hỏi ngày càng được doanh nghiệp quan tâm khi AI bắt đầu tham gia trực tiếp vào quy trình phát triển phần mềm.
Về bản chất, Claude Code là công cụ kết hợp giữa môi trường local và xử lý trên cloud. Điều đó có nghĩa một phần dữ liệu cần được gửi tới model để suy luận. Tuy nhiên việc dữ liệu được lưu thế nào, dùng để huấn luyện hay không và thời gian lưu giữ phụ thuộc vào loại tài khoản, nền tảng sử dụng và chính sách triển khai.
Vì vậy với dự án thương mại hoặc dữ liệu nhạy cảm, doanh nghiệp thường triển khai qua các nền tảng cloud có chính sách quản trị riêng thay vì dùng trực tiếp như người dùng cá nhân.
Một nguyên tắc phổ biến hiện nay là: AI chỉ nên được cấp quyền đọc đúng phần cần thiết, không nên mở toàn bộ hệ thống nếu không có lý do rõ ràng.
Claude đứng ở đâu trong cuộc đua AI hiện nay?
Thị trường AI đang chuyển rất nhanh và mỗi nền tảng bắt đầu có thế mạnh riêng.
ChatGPT đang đi theo hướng nền tảng AI đa năng với hệ sinh thái công cụ rộng. Gemini tập trung mạnh vào đa phương thức và tích hợp với sản phẩm của Google. Trong khi đó Claude xây dựng hình ảnh như một AI thiên về suy luận dài, đọc tài liệu lớn và hỗ trợ lập trình.
Điều thú vị là cuộc cạnh tranh hiện nay không còn là “AI nào thông minh hơn”, mà dần chuyển thành “AI nào phù hợp với công việc nào hơn”.
Tương lai: từ lập trình viên viết code sang lập trình viên điều phối AI
Khoảng 10 năm trước, kỹ năng quan trọng nhất của lập trình viên là tự viết được nhiều code. Ngày nay, kỹ năng ngày càng quan trọng lại là hiểu hệ thống, đặt yêu cầu đúng và biết đánh giá kết quả.
AI đang thay đổi cách làm việc theo hướng mới: con người định nghĩa vấn đề, còn AI thực hiện những phần lặp lại.
Điều đó không có nghĩa lập trình viên biến mất. Ngược lại, người hiểu nghiệp vụ, kiến trúc và biết phối hợp với AI sẽ trở nên giá trị hơn.
Và có lẽ đó cũng là lý do Claude Code được chú ý đến vậy: nó không cố thay thế lập trình viên, mà đang biến lập trình viên thành người điều phối nhiều hơn là người gõ từng dòng code.
Claude Code có thật sự giúp lập trình nhanh hơn không?
Câu trả lời ngắn là có — nhưng không phải theo cách nhiều người nghĩ.
Claude không biến một người chưa biết lập trình thành kỹ sư phần mềm chỉ sau một đêm. Giá trị lớn nhất của nó nằm ở việc giảm thời gian cho những phần lặp lại: đọc code cũ, tìm file liên quan, viết test, refactor, giải thích tài liệu hoặc tạo phiên bản đầu tiên của một tính năng.
Nhiều đội ngũ kỹ thuật hiện nay không còn đo “AI viết được bao nhiêu dòng code”, mà đo xem AI giúp giảm bao nhiêu thời gian chuyển ngữ cảnh giữa các công việc.
Ví dụ trước đây một lập trình viên mất 2 giờ để hiểu module cũ rồi mới bắt đầu sửa lỗi. Giờ AI có thể giúp tóm tắt hệ thống trong vài phút để con người tập trung vào quyết định kỹ thuật.
Chi phí sử dụng Claude thực tế như thế nào?
Một điều khá thú vị là khi dùng Claude qua giao diện chat, người dùng thường không cảm nhận được token đang tiêu thụ. Nhưng phía sau, mọi thao tác đều có chi phí xử lý.
Có ba thứ ảnh hưởng trực tiếp tới mức sử dụng:
- Lượng dữ liệu AI phải đọc (input)
- Lượng nội dung AI sinh ra (output)
- Độ dài của ngữ cảnh đang giữ trong phiên làm việc
Điều này giải thích vì sao cùng một câu hỏi nhưng một người dùng dự án nhỏ có thể phản hồi rất nhanh, còn một người mở cả repository lớn lại thấy thời gian xử lý tăng lên đáng kể.
Với lập trình, tối ưu prompt đôi khi còn quan trọng không kém tối ưu code.
Những việc Claude hiện tại vẫn chưa làm tốt
Dù rất mạnh, Claude không phải công cụ hoàn hảo.
Nó vẫn có thể hiểu sai yêu cầu, suy luận sai kiến trúc hoặc tạo ra những thay đổi nhìn hợp lý nhưng gây lỗi ở nơi khác. Đây là hiện tượng mà cộng đồng thường gọi vui là “AI tự tin nhưng sai”.
Đặc biệt với các hệ thống lớn, AI chưa thể thay thế hoàn toàn việc review của con người.
Những phần vẫn cần kỹ sư kiểm tra kỹ gồm:
- Thiết kế hệ thống
- Bảo mật
- Tối ưu hiệu năng
- Kiến trúc dữ liệu
- Logic nghiệp vụ
Vì vậy cách dùng hiệu quả nhất hiện nay không phải giao toàn bộ cho AI, mà để AI làm nhanh phần thực thi và để con người chịu trách nhiệm phần quyết định.
AI Agent sẽ thay đổi cách viết phần mềm như thế nào?
Trong nhiều năm, lập trình được hiểu là hành động ngồi trước màn hình và tự viết từng dòng lệnh.
Nhưng xu hướng mới đang xuất hiện: lập trình viên chuyển dần từ người trực tiếp viết sang người điều phối.
Thay vì tự tạo từng file, con người mô tả mục tiêu, đặt ràng buộc, kiểm tra kết quả và ra quyết định cuối cùng.
Một workflow mới đang hình thành:
Con người → định nghĩa bài toán → AI phân tích → AI triển khai → con người review → AI chỉnh sửa → triển khai.
Nếu xu hướng này tiếp tục, kỹ năng quan trọng nhất trong vài năm tới có thể không còn là gõ code thật nhanh, mà là khả năng giao việc tốt cho AI và biết đánh giá kết quả nó tạo ra.
Kết luận cuối
Claude không phải một công cụ thần kỳ thay thế lập trình viên. Nhưng nó là dấu hiệu cho thấy ngành phần mềm đang bước sang một giai đoạn mới — nơi việc hiểu hệ thống và phối hợp với AI có thể trở thành kỹ năng quan trọng hơn việc tự viết mọi thứ từ đầu.
Và có lẽ đó cũng là thay đổi lớn nhất mà Claude đang đại diện: AI không còn chỉ trả lời câu hỏi… mà đang bắt đầu tham gia trực tiếp vào công việc.
Vì sao Claude Code lại tốn token?
Claude Code tốn token vì nó không chỉ xử lý câu lệnh của bạn. Nó còn phải đọc file, đọc folder, đọc context, đọc output terminal và đôi khi đọc cả lịch sử cuộc trò chuyện trước đó. Càng để Claude tự khám phá nhiều file, token tiêu thụ càng lớn.
Ví dụ bạn bảo Claude “đọc toàn bộ repo rồi tối ưu giúp tôi”, nó có thể phải quét rất nhiều file. Nhưng nếu bạn nói rõ “chỉ kiểm tra thư mục auth và sửa lỗi đăng nhập”, lượng token sẽ thấp hơn nhiều. Vì vậy dùng Claude Code hiệu quả không chỉ là biết hỏi, mà còn là biết giới hạn phạm vi công việc.
Claude chạy trên nền tảng nào?
Claude là sản phẩm của Anthropic. Người dùng có thể dùng Claude qua website/app của Claude, qua API của Anthropic hoặc thông qua các nền tảng cloud lớn như Amazon Bedrock, Google Vertex AI và Microsoft Foundry. Với Claude Code, người dùng thường làm việc qua terminal hoặc môi trường lập trình, còn model thật sự vẫn xử lý trên hạ tầng cloud.
Claude có thay lập trình viên không?
Claude Code không nên được hiểu là công cụ thay thế hoàn toàn lập trình viên. Nó giống một trợ lý kỹ thuật rất khỏe: đọc nhanh, sửa nhanh, viết nhanh, nhưng vẫn cần người kiểm tra kiến trúc, logic nghiệp vụ, bảo mật và chất lượng cuối cùng. Nếu giao việc mơ hồ, nó vẫn có thể sửa sai hướng. Nếu dùng đúng, nó giúp tiết kiệm rất nhiều thời gian ở những việc lặp lại.
Dùng Claude Code thế nào cho hiệu quả?
Cách dùng tốt nhất là giao việc rõ phạm vi. Thay vì yêu cầu “sửa toàn bộ project”, nên nói rõ thư mục nào, lỗi gì, mục tiêu là gì và không được động vào phần nào. Với dự án lớn, nên chia nhỏ task: đọc trước, đề xuất hướng sửa, sau đó mới cho chỉnh file. Cách này vừa tiết kiệm token vừa giảm nguy cơ AI sửa lan man.
Kết luận
Claude AI là một trong những mô hình đáng chú ý nhất hiện nay, đặc biệt với nhóm làm kỹ thuật và lập trình. Điểm mạnh của Claude không chỉ nằm ở việc viết câu trả lời hay, mà ở khả năng đọc ngữ cảnh dài, hiểu codebase lớn và hỗ trợ công việc theo kiểu agent.
Nếu phải mô tả Claude Code bằng một câu ngắn gọn thì có thể nói: đây không phải AI viết từng dòng code nhanh nhất, mà là AI chịu ngồi đọc cả dự án trước khi bắt đầu viết. Và trong thế giới lập trình, đôi khi người chịu đọc kỹ trước khi sửa mới là người đáng giá nhất.